Composting

Composting is our hands-on solution to food waste and methane emissions. Our composting initiative involves:

  • partnering with local businesses/cafes

  • collecting organic waste (coffee grounds) and transporting them to composting facilities

  • reaching out to local farmers or community gardens who need compost

By transforming waste into nutrient-rich compost that supports sustainable agriculture, we reduce greenhouse gas emissions, support local ecosystems, and model a circular, climate-conscious approach to waste.
